因为公司服务器端数据库提供的是内网地址,远程连接无法直接通过内网地址进行连接,只能在命令行输入mycli -h + 内网地址命令进行访问。
现在提供一种简易的方式去连接服务器端的数据库内网地址
侦听端口是你本地自定义的端口号,如3307
而3306是mysql数据库的默认端口
切记,这两个不要混淆
-
打开Xshell客户端,连接上远程服务器。(这样的地址是数据库的内网地址,公网貌似可以直接访问)
-
然后右键点击服务器选项,在隧道选项中,配置本地监听的地址(侦听端口写你自己定义的,目标主机写你服务器的内网地址)例如 本地 127.0.0.1:3307 => 服务器(这地址是我瞎写的,要写你自己的内网地址) 10.10.155.16:3306
-
隧道建立好之后,在Idea中配置数据库的本地地址(如图),但是账户密码需要写的是服务器内网的账号密码(切记),你就可以直接在本地建立连接,监听3307端口就可以了(类似于内网穿透的意思)
连接成功,你就可以为所欲为地操作数据库了(注意!!!如果是生产数据库,那还是小心点操作,毕竟出现问题。。。你懂得)至此,告一段落,如果有连接不上的,或者看不懂的,欢迎留言咨询,感谢观看!!!✿✿ヽ(°▽°)ノ✿